- cīnctūtus adj.
[2 cinctus], girded, girt (rare): Luperci, O.: Cethegi, i. e. the ancients, H.
* * *cinctuta, cinctutum ADJwearing girdle or loin-cloth; girded/girt; (as ancients whose toga was girded)
